Band/artist history
Gary Trovato is a singer/songwriter hailing from Melbourne, Australia. He is best known for his work with the Hard Rock outfit, Supercharger (active 2001-2007). With Supercharger, Gary released the critically acclaimed albums Vision for the Blind (2003) and Reckoning Day (2006). The latter featured the Australian MP3 chart toppers "Make It Back" and "Jaded", and saw Supercharger headlining sold out shows at The Palace and the Hi Fi Bar. In addition, Gary has written and recorded songs for numerous movies and television shows. Some of his notable achievements include: - Writer & performer of "Make It Back" which was used as the theme song for Melbourne TV program, "The Sauce" and also featured in the movie, "Scary Legends". - Singer of Jesus Cant Skate and Rolaboi which featured in the movie Jesus Cant Skate starring Melissa George. - Writer of the theme song for the Australian television show Vocal Art TV - Winner of the 2004 Vocal Art Studios Perpetual Trophy In November 2007 Gary began work on his much anticipated solo album, "Somewhere Between Heaven & Hell". This thought-provoking and hard-hitting concept album explores the hypocrisy of religion and how it is used to instill fear in the masses and wage wars in the name of an imaginary God. Somewhere Between Heaven & Hell will be released in March 2009. Gary will be touring with his new band, "Angel Down" in 2009 in support of the new album.
